- Siemens| offers a broad range of automation solutions, including programmable logic controllers (PLCs), industrial drives, and systems.
- Allen-Bradley| is renowned for its robust PLCs, HMIs, and network solutions.
- ABB| provides a diverse portfolio of robotics, motors, drives, and power solutions.
- Schneider Electric| specializes in electrical distribution, automation, and software solutions for industrial applications.
